引言
Oracle数据库是世界上最流行的数据库之一,广泛应用于企业级应用中。对于数据库管理员(DBA)或开发者来说,掌握Oracle数据库的安装与配置是必不可少的技能。本文将详细讲解Oracle数据库客户端的安装与配置过程,帮助您轻松上手。
1. Oracle数据库客户端简介
Oracle数据库客户端是Oracle数据库软件的一个组成部分,它允许用户远程连接到Oracle数据库服务器,执行各种数据库操作,如查询、更新、备份和恢复等。Oracle数据库客户端分为多个版本,包括Oracle Instant Client、Oracle Client等。
2. 安装Oracle数据库客户端
以下是Oracle数据库客户端的安装步骤:
2.1 准备工作
- 下载Oracle数据库客户端:访问Oracle官方网站下载适合您操作系统的Oracle客户端软件。
- 创建用户:确保您以root用户登录操作系统,并为Oracle客户端创建一个用户,例如
oracle
。
sudo useradd oracle
sudo passwd oracle
- 设置环境变量:将Oracle客户端的bin目录添加到系统环境变量中。
sudo vi /etc/profile
在文件末尾添加以下行:
export ORACLE_HOME=/path/to/oracle/client
export PATH=$PATH:$ORACLE_HOME/bin
保存并关闭文件,然后使用以下命令使更改生效:
source /etc/profile
2.2 安装Oracle客户端
- 切换到oracle用户:
su - oracle
- 运行安装脚本:
cd /path/to/oracle/client
./runInstaller
- 跟随安装向导:按照提示进行操作,直至安装完成。
3. 配置Oracle客户端
安装完成后,您需要配置Oracle客户端以连接到Oracle数据库服务器。
3.1 创建配置文件
- 创建配置文件目录:
mkdir -p $ORACLE_HOME/network/admin
- 创建配置文件:
vi $ORACLE_HOME/network/admin/sqlnet.ora
添加以下内容:
NAMES.DIRECTORY_PATH= (TNSNAMES, EZCONNECT)
- 创建tnsnames.ora文件:
vi $ORACLE_HOME/network/admin/tnsnames.ora
添加以下内容(根据您的数据库服务器信息进行修改):
your_server =
(DESCRIPTION =
(ADDRESS = (PROTOCOL = TCP)(HOST = your_host)(PORT = your_port))
(CONNECT_DATA =
(SERVICE_NAME = your_service_name)
)
)
3.2 测试连接
- 连接到数据库:
sqlplus username/password@your_server
- 检查版本信息:
SELECT * FROM v$version;
如果连接成功,您将看到数据库版本信息。
4. 总结
通过以上步骤,您已经成功安装并配置了Oracle数据库客户端。现在,您可以开始使用Oracle数据库进行各种操作了。如果您在安装或配置过程中遇到任何问题,可以参考Oracle官方文档或寻求社区帮助。